Instance Name used by Configuration Assistant

I think this has been asked before, but I can't it using the search function.

When cataloging remote databases using DB2 8.1 Client Configuration Assistant, the instance name appears to be random name such as NDEE60EE(DB2). This is not the real instance name. When cataloging multiple databases under the same instance, it creates multiple different instance names on the GUI display instead of reusing the real instance name.

Does anyone know how to fix this?
